Finding a Marketing Ops Agency To Build An Engine

Marketing operations is easy to overlook, but in B2B SaaS it’s often the difference between chaotic activity and predictable growth. Anyone can launch campaigns or create content the real challenge is building the systems, processes, and data foundations that keep everything running smoothly and show what’s actually working.

Great marketing ops isn’t about fancy dashboards or over-engineered automation. It’s about creating clarity: aligning teams, standardising processes, improving data quality, and making sure every tool in the stack is connected and serving a purpose. It’s turning a complex product and buying journey into a repeatable, measurable engine that supports sales and marketing, not slows them down.

For SaaS companies, marketing operations is a mix of systems design, analytics, enablement, and continuous optimisation. It’s ensuring attribution is accurate, handoffs are seamless, and insights are actionable. It’s building a foundation where strategy and execution can thrive and where experiments reveal which activities drive real pipeline and revenue.

The best marketing operations teams don’t obsess over busywork or vanity metrics. They focus on efficiency, data integrity, process improvements, and full-funnel visibility. FAQs

Some common questions, answered around SaaS digital marketing agencies and how to select the right one for your business.

What does a marketing operations agency actually do?

A marketing ops agency helps you build the systems, processes, and data foundations that make your entire go-to-market engine run smoothly. This can include CRM setup, attribution, automation, reporting, funnel design, lead routing, tool integrations, and ongoing optimisation. In short, they make sure your marketing and sales teams have the clarity and infrastructure they need to scale.

How do I know if my SaaS company needs a marketing ops agency?

If your reporting is inconsistent, your tech stack feels messy, leads fall through the cracks, or your team spends more time fixing problems than executing campaigns, it’s usually time to bring in help. A marketing ops agency is especially valuable when growth accelerates and internal processes can’t keep up, or when you don’t have the in-house expertise to build a scalable system.

What should I look for in a marketing ops agency?

Look for teams that understand SaaS funnels, can work across your entire tech stack (HubSpot, Salesforce, Marketo, Pardot, etc.), and have strong experience with attribution, automation, and data cleanliness. A good agency will ask smart questions, prioritise clarity over complexity, and focus on improving your operational efficiency, not just adding more tools.

How long does it take to see results from marketing ops work?

Foundational improvements can show benefits within a few weeks — clearer reporting, smoother lead flow, faster campaign launches. Bigger initiatives like attribution models, complex integrations, or full CRM rebuilds may take 60–120 days. The value compounds over time as your systems become cleaner, more accurate, and easier to optimise.

Should we hire a marketing ops agency or bring someone in-house?

It depends on your stage. Early and growth-stage SaaS companies often benefit from an agency because they get senior expertise without hiring a full team. Larger organisations may eventually need a dedicated in-house ops function. A good rule: hire an agency to build the foundation and processes, then bring in-house ops to maintain and scale them.
